The overview below groups typical Wood Siding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in West Milford, NJ.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Material Costs - The cost of wood siding materials typically ranges from $3 to $8 per square foot, depending on wood type and quality. For a standard 1,500-square-foot home, material expenses can be between $4,500 and $12,000. Local pros can provide estimates based on specific material choices.
Labor Expenses - Installation labor usually costs between $2 and $6 per square foot, which can amount to approximately $3,000 to $9,000 for an average-sized project. Labor costs vary based on project complexity and local market rates.
Additional Costs - Extra expenses may include surface preparation, removal of old siding, or repairs, often adding $1 to $3 per square foot. These costs depend on the condition of existing surfaces and project scope.
Total Project Price - Overall costs for wood siding installation typically range from $5,500 to $21,000 for a standard home, but prices can vary based on size, material choices, and local contractor rates. Contact local service providers for customized estimates.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What types of wood siding installation services are available? Local contractors typically offer installation of various wood siding styles such as clapboard, shingles, shakes, and board-and-batten to suit different aesthetic preferences.
How long does a wood siding installation usually take? The duration depends on the size of the project and the type of siding, but most installations are completed within a few days to a week.
What factors should be considered before installing wood siding? Important considerations include the home's architecture, climate conditions, moisture protection, and the desired appearance of the finished siding.
Are there maintenance requirements for wood siding after installation? Yes, wood siding typically requires regular staining or sealing to protect against weathering and maintain its appearance.
